Received a White 40w & Blue 70w Tesla Stealths today from VaporBeast. Haven't opened the 40w yet. I ordered them without the tanks.

The 70w is a bit taller (1/2") & heavier than Knight V2. Tesla seems to fire slightly faster on a button press than the Knight on identical attys, but seems to have a much longer ramp up to temp in ss TC Mode at identical settings. This could because 70w-80w upper limits means the Knight has more power available, but I believe the Knight has a greater operational preheat punch in TC as well. The Tesla has a Mech, VW, Ni200, Ti & SS Operating Modes. The Knight V2 has VV, VW, Ni200, Ti, SS316, Ti, NC & 3 TCR Operating Modes.

The cage on the Tesla has the third cage ring so it will protect the atty better in a fall. The Atty well on the Tesla is deeper & will accommodate taller tanks more naturally. The top of a Cubis Tank barely peeks out over the cage.

The firing position hearkens back to my Kato Square Box Mod days so no big deal for me, but the height of the mod does make it a bit of a stretch for smaller hands in a thumb firing position. Find it a bit more comfortable with an index finger firing position. Price was right but I gotta give the edge to the Knight despite it being more expensive.

Now, relating to the device itself >

The Moonraker is what the Railbox wanted to be. That was also a marvelous device but the size made it almost unusable. By bringing it down to almost Billet Box/Xvo proportions, Paolo solved that, and while it might not be quite as portable as those other two I mentioned, it's a very worthy competitor, especially for anyone who is brand-loyal to SunBox.

I love the fact that he added a locking nut to the elevator, and I also love the adjustable (not spring loaded) 510 connector. Xvo did the latter too, and I simply prefer the manual approach (I also drive a 6 speed car). It's much more reliable for the long run of the device.

The anodization work is superb, and I also love that he secured the battery in inside there, without using pressure to accomplish it. The battery cap is also a big win (great design and easy to use).

The weight is also very good, within spitting distance of the Xvo (loaded). VERY portable, especially during the winter months (with a jacket or coat). Not the BEST in a pair of jeans (due mainly to the sharper top , but still quite doable. It's coming out with me today in fact, for an appointment I have this morning.

All in all, I love it. I love holding it, using it, and certainly looking at it (it's beautiful!).
